Transaction 2876840a250af872e5d717ce48b94a4cb3dffc0e9b3961d76e611ba13f68042d

3 Input
1 Outputs
  • 2876840a250af872e5d717ce48b94a4cb3dffc0e9b3961d76e611ba13f68042d:0
  • value  13082040
    address  3FmKbGJk7f6EkyGDWN3Zz8Nid8mZAAszoD